WA 95 (12/2008): The prodigious 2006 Cabernet Sauvignon Reserve (75% Cabernet Sauvignon, 12% Merlot, 8+% Petit Verdot, and about 5% Cabernet Franc) reveals aromas of flowers, espresso roast, blackberries, and creme de cassis. This exuberant, rich, full-bodied Cabernet coats the palate, but is neither heavy nor overbearing. Sweet, substantial, well-integrated tannins along with decent acidity, and a stunningly long, 50-second finish make for a compelling glass of young, but promising Cabernet Sauvignon. This 2006 should hit its peak in 3-5 years, and last for 25 or more.. WS 94 (7/2009): A touch earthy at first, but the flavors build and expand, with a medley of herb and mineral joined by dry currant, cedar and spice. Very Pauillac-like in its structure, balance and restraint. Keeps getting better with every sip. Best from 2010 through 2017. 1,000 cases made VM 94 (6/2009): Dark ruby. Currant, minerals, dark chocolate, tobacco, loam, smoke, roast coffee and spicebox scents on the complex nose. Lush, concentrated and broad, with a seamless texture and a captivating restrained sweetness. A wine with serious stuffing, and a step up in intensity and suavity from the Ranch bottling. Finishes very long, with slowly mounting flavors and sweet tannins. |

| WA 92 (12/2010): A dramatic upgrade, the 2008 Cabernet Sauvignon Reserve exhibits aromas of creme de cassis, burning embers, licorice and smoked herbs. It ratchets up the body, concentration and depth yet possesses silky smooth tannins and a forward style. This beauty should drink well for 15+ years. |
